A city in central Germany in the state of Thuringia. In the northern foothills of the Thuringian Forest, on the Hesel River, 48 kilometers east of Erfurt. The city was established in 1283. The Liberal National Association was formed here in 1859. In 1869, the German workers' associations held a congress here to establish the German Social Democratic Labour Party. Traffic to stop. Industries include machinery manufacturing (automobiles, agricultural machinery, etc.), chemistry, metal processing, electrical equipment, textiles, wood processing, food processing, etc. Rock salt and potash are mined nearby. There are churches from the 12th to 13th centuries, palaces and castles from the 18th century. Tour the center.
